- The distance between Bandar Lengeh, Iran and Masatepe, Nicaragua is approximately 14,011 km or 8,707 mi.
- To reach Bandar Lengeh in this distance one would set out from Masatepe bearing 44.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Bandar Lengeh bearing 130.4° or SE .
- Bandar Lengeh has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Masatepe has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Bandar Lengeh is in or near the tropical desert scrub biome whereas Masatepe is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 3.3 °C (5.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.9 °C (23.2°F) more in Bandar Lengeh.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1231.7 mm (48.5 in) less which is equivalent to 1231.7 l/m² (30.23 US gal/ft²) or 12,317,000 l/ha (1,316,769 US gal/ac) less. About 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.6° lower in Bandar Lengeh than in Masatepe.
